Augustin is a 46 year-old married man, living with his wife and their five children in the Northern District of Rwanda. They are happy that all of their children are attending school. Augustin and his wife are both farmers. His wife grows a variety of seasonal crops for family consumption and sells the surplus for extra income, while he specialises in banana farming.
Augustin has now been cultivating bananas for over ten years, with support from his wife. After realising the profitability of his banana plantation, Augustin aims to expand his banana farming. Currently, he grows bananas on one hectare of farmland but plans to increase his production and sales. He therefore decided to apply for a loan to purchase an additional hectare of farmland, which will enable him to harvest around eight tonnes of bananas from the new land. This expansion is expected to boost his production and income, allowing him to repay the loan without any issues.
His wife will assist with selling the bananas, while Augustin focuses mainly on farming activities. He currently employs five workers and plans to hire five more to help prepare the new land and plant banana seedlings. The additional income will help cover education costs for their children and other household expenses. Augustin believes that, in the future, his farming activities will more than double in size.
